Björn Borg: Timeline of Career & Financial Milestones
- 1973: Turned professional at age 15; youngest Davis Cup match winner ever. (International Tennis Hall of Fame)
- 1974: Won first French Open, youngest men’s singles champion at 18. (International Tennis Hall of Fame)
- 1975: Defended French Open title; led Sweden to first Davis Cup win with a record streak. (International Tennis Hall of Fame)
- 1976-1980: Won five straight Wimbledon titles, including legendary 1980 final over John McEnroe. (Britannica)
- 1978-1981: Won four consecutive French Open titles (six in total), broke $1M annual prize barrier in 1979. (Wikipedia; ATP Tour)
- 1981: Last Grand Slam finals (Wimbledon, US Open), both vs. McEnroe. (Britannica)
- 1983: Retired at 26 after 64 singles titles, 11 Grand Slam wins. (Wikipedia)
- 1991-1993: Brief comeback attempts, no major financial/tennis milestones. (Wikipedia)
- Post-1983: No confirmed public details of business ventures, house value, or new endorsements in available, verified reporting.
- 2020s: Occasional team captain roles (e.g., Laver Cup captain); no material financial disclosures.
